Tableau Public
Tableau Public is a free, user-friendly tool for creating and sharing data visualizations online. It allows users to explore and present data in an accessible format, making it ideal for data analysts, educators, and anyone looking to communicate data insights effectively. Its public sharing feature enhances collaboration and transparency.
Enables users to create and share data visualizations online for free.
Pros
- + Free to use with no cost barriers.
- + User-friendly interface accessible to non-experts.
- + Supports public sharing, enhancing collaboration and data transparency.
Cons
- - Limited advanced features compared to paid versions.
- - No auto-update functionality, potentially affecting compatibility.
